Inspection History
Dec 17, 2025
Food Service Establishment Inspection
6 minor violations.
View 6 violations
Food properly labeled; original container, required records available
Inspector notes: Improper labeling of food containers inside the refrigerators. Ensure all food are labeled once outside the original containers.
Food and nonfood-contact surfaces cleanable, properly designed, constructed, and used
Inspector notes: Cutting board on the prep table is stained and bruised. Cutting boards need to be replaced.
Nonfood-contact surfaces clean
Inspector notes: Exterior of kitchen equipment has food debris and need to be cleaned. Ensure kitchen equipment is cleaned and maintained to prevent possible food contamination.
Toilet facilities: properly constructed, supplied, cleaned
Inspector notes: Women's bathroom is not cleaned. Ensure all bathrooms are cleaned regularly for sanitary use.
Physical facilities installed, maintained, and clean
Inspector notes: Walls stained, Ceiling stained and damaged. Physical facility has to be cleaned and maintained for compliance.
Adequate ventilation and lighting; designated areas used
Inspector notes: Vents throughout facility has dust buildup and need cleaning. Ensure vents are cleaned to prevent possible food contamination.
